Key Points:

  • Soccer player Jorginho Frello publicly criticized pop singer Chappell Roan after a security guard allegedly scolded his stepdaughter and wife for getting too close to Roan at a São Paulo hotel, causing distress to the child.
  • Roan denied involvement, stating she did not see or interact with the family and condemned the assumption that her security was responsible, emphasizing she does not hate fans or children.
  • The incident sparked backlash against Roan, including a call from Rio de Janeiro's mayor to ban her from a local music festival, highlighting ongoing tensions around Roan's firm boundaries with fans.
  • Critics argue Frello's public reaction was disproportionate, potentially teaching his stepdaughter to respond to hurt feelings with public shaming rather than understanding the complexities of fame.
  • The controversy underscores the challenges celebrities face balancing personal boundaries with fan expectations, and the importance of teaching children about the realities of public life and fame.
